Abstract

The utility model discloses a wood board feeding device which is used for placing wood board raw materials from a material storage station to an installation station and comprises a material conveying unit and an aligning unit, wherein the material conveying unit comprises a material conveying driving piece, a moving frame and a grabbing mechanism, the moving frame can control the grabbing mechanism to move back and forth in the material storage station and lift under the driving of the material conveying driving piece, the grabbing mechanism can grab or release the wood board raw materials, the aligning unit comprises an aligning driving piece and an aligning plate, and the aligning plate can align and position the wood board raw materials on the installation station through the driving piece of the aligning driving piece. By adopting the automatic loading and unloading device, the wood boards in the storage bin can be automatically and accurately conveyed to the installation station, the matching precision of the installation procedure is improved, and the production efficiency is improved.

Description

Plank loading attachment
Technical Field
The utility model relates to the field of wood board assembling equipment, in particular to a wood board feeding device.
Background
The existing wood board assembly production line assembles wood boards and wood strips to form cover plates, and needs to use the raw materials such as the wood boards and the wood strips. In the existing production line, workers often move the wood board to an installation station by a manual carrying method and then install the wood board and the wood battens. Because the operation of different workers is different, the positions of the wood boards placed in the installation stations cannot be unified, so that the matching precision of subsequent installation procedures is easily influenced, and the manual placing mode has low efficiency and slow tempo, cannot be uninterruptedly produced on a large scale, and influences the production efficiency.

The movable frame 12 includes a first vertical frame 121 and a second vertical frame 122, the first vertical frame 121 is respectively disposed at the head end and the tail end of the installation station 4, and the crossing direction of the first vertical frame 121 is perpendicular to a connection line between the head end and the tail end of the installation station 4. The second standing frame 122 is located above the first standing frame 121, and the crossing direction of the second standing frame 122 is parallel to the line connecting the head end and the tail end of the installation station 4. The first vertical frame 121 and the second vertical frame 122 are matched, so that the grabbing mechanism 13 can move perpendicular to a connecting line between the head end and the tail end of the installation station 4 and can also lift up and down, and the wood board raw material 5 can be conveniently sucked and placed into the installation station 4. The moving frame 12 further includes a connecting plate 123, two ends of the connecting plate 123 are respectively connected to the first vertical frames 121 at the head end and the tail end of the installation station 4, and preferably, the connecting plate 123 is parallel to the installation station 4. The second stand 122 stands above the connecting plate 123.
Referring to fig. 3, the grabbing mechanism 13 includes a guide rod 131 and a suction plate 132, a through hole corresponding to the cross-sectional size of the guide rod 131 is formed in the connecting plate 123, the guide rod 131 penetrates through the connecting plate 123, the connecting plate 123 plays a role in carrying the second vertical frame 122 and also plays a role in guiding the guide rod 131, the connecting plate 123 can limit the moving direction of the guide rod 131, the suction plate 132 is fixed at the bottom of the guide rod 131, the suction plate 132 is communicated with an external air pump, and the suction plate 132 can suck or loosen the wood board raw material 5 by using a negative pressure principle. The gripping mechanism 13 may also be a conventional mechanical claw or other mechanism or device.
The material conveying driving member 11 includes a first driving member 111, and the first driving member 111 is preferably a rotating motor, and may be other mechanisms or devices having a rotating characteristic. The first driving member 111 is fixed to the connecting plate 123, and a transmission member is fixed to an upper portion of the first stand 121, and the transmission member is preferably a rack, and may be a component or a device having a transmission characteristic, such as a chain or a transmission belt. The first driving member 111 is connected to the transmission member, and the first driving member 111 and the transmission member are relatively displaced by rotation, and since the transmission member is fixed to the first vertical frame 121 and the first driving member 111 is fixed to the connecting plate 123, the connecting plate 123 can be driven to reciprocate in a direction perpendicular to a line connecting the head end and the tail end of the installation station 4. The material conveying driving member 11 includes a second driving member 112, and the second driving member 112 is preferably a linear cylinder, and may also have a mechanism or device such as a cam mechanism, a link mechanism, etc. with a reciprocating linear motion characteristic. The second driving member 112 is disposed on the upper portion of the second vertical frame 122, the second driving member 112 is connected to the upper portion of the guide rod 131, and the second driving member 112 can drive the guide rod 131 to reciprocate up and down.
